Morning: Start your cultural immersion in Madrid by visiting the beautiful Royal Palace (Palacio Real), one of the city's top attractions. Marvel at the opulent interiors and explore the surrounding gardens.
Afternoon: Head to the Prado Museum, home to a vast collection of European masterpieces, including works by Velázquez, Goya, and El Greco.
Evening: End the day with a visit to Mercado de San Miguel, a vibrant food market offering a wide variety of Spanish delicacies. Taste tapas, sip on local wines, and soak in the lively atmosphere.
Morning: Take a morning train to Barcelona, the vibrant capital of Catalonia. Start your day with a visit to Park Güell, a UNESCO World Heritage Site designed by Antoni Gaudí. Explore its unique architecture and enjoy panoramic views of the city.
Afternoon: Immerse yourself in the artistic atmosphere of the Picasso Museum, housing an extensive collection of the iconic artist's works. Take a stroll along the famous La Rambla street and indulge in some shopping and coffee breaks.
Evening: Witness the magnificent magic fountain show at Montjuïc, where music and lights come together to create a mesmerizing spectacle.
Morning: Depart Barcelona and take a train to Toulouse, France. Start your day by exploring the heart of the city, the Place du Capitole. Admire the impressive architecture of the Capitole building and enjoy the vibrant atmosphere.
Afternoon: Visit the Musée des Augustins, home to a remarkable collection of sculptures and paintings. Explore the charming streets of the historic Saint-Etienne district and discover its unique shops and coffee houses.
Evening: Head to the iconic Pont Neuf bridge to capture stunning pictures of the Garonne River and enjoy the sunset.
Morning: Take a scenic bus ride to Andorra la Vella, the capital of Andorra. Start your day by exploring the charming old town (Barri Antic) and its narrow streets filled with shops and cafes.
Afternoon: Visit the Casa de la Vall, a historic house that serves as the Andorran parliament. Explore its rich history and admire the architectural beauty.
Evening: Enjoy a warm cup of coffee at one of Andorra la Vella's cozy cafes while taking in the picturesque mountain views.
Morning: Leave Andorra and take a train to Lyon, France. Start your day by visiting the beautiful Basilique Notre Dame de Fourvière, offering panoramic views of the city.
Afternoon: Explore the Musée des Beaux-Arts, one of France's largest art museums, housing an impressive collection of paintings, sculptures, and decorative arts.
Evening: Take a leisurely stroll along the charming waterfront promenade, Quai Saint-Antoine, and stop by a local cafe for a cup of coffee and people-watching.
Morning: Depart Lyon and take a train to Nice, a charming city on the French Riviera. Start your day by visiting the famous Promenade des Anglais, a picturesque waterfront promenade lined with palm trees and cafes.
Afternoon: Explore the Musée Matisse, dedicated to the works of the renowned artist Henri Matisse. Take a walk through the colorful streets of the Old Town (Vieux Nice) and try some local delicacies.
Evening: Capture beautiful sunset pictures at the Castle Hill (Colline du Château) and enjoy panoramic views of Nice.
Morning: Depart Nice and take a train to Milan, Italy, to continue your journey. Prepare for your trip to Italy by exploring the city's shopping district and buying warm clothes if needed.
Afternoon: Visit the famous Duomo di Milano, a magnificent cathedral that stands as the symbol of Milan. Explore its intricate architecture and climb to the rooftop for panoramic views.
Evening: Take a relaxing break at a local cafe to enjoy a cup of Italian coffee before heading to your next destination.
While visiting Barcelona, don't miss the chance to explore the lesser-known neighborhood of Gràcia. This bohemian district is filled with narrow streets, charming squares, and eclectic shops. It offers a more local and authentic experience away from the bustling tourist areas.
In Lyon, take a short trip to the town of Annecy, known as the "Venice of the Alps." Explore its enchanting canals, picturesque streets, and visit the Château d'Annecy, a beautifully preserved castle overlooking Lake Annecy.
In Nice, venture outside the city to discover the charming village of Èze. Perched on a hilltop, Èze offers stunning views of the Mediterranean Sea and is home to the historic Jardin Exotique, a serene garden filled with exotic plants.
For a unique cultural experience in Milan, visit the Navigli district. Explore the vibrant canal district, known for its lively nightlife, trendy bars, and art galleries. Don't forget to check out the picturesque Naviglio Grande canal.
